Lincoln County, Colorado Employment Sector Breakdown

SectorTotal WorkersPercentage
Private For-Profit1,10152.0%
Government57927.3%
Self-Employed26812.7%
Private Non-Profit1607.6%

Lincoln County, Colorado Historical Employment Sector Trends

YearPrivateGovSelf-EmpNon-Profit
202452.0%27.3%12.7%7.6%
202354.7%24.5%13.1%7.5%
202255.0%22.7%15.5%6.4%
202149.2%28.3%14.5%7.7%
202049.7%28.8%15.1%6.1%
201948.1%30.2%14.5%6.1%
201848.7%31.1%14.4%5.0%
201748.2%29.1%14.5%7.3%
201649.2%27.3%15.8%6.5%
201545.8%27.6%16.4%8.9%
201446.2%30.5%15.6%7.3%
201348.8%32.0%11.8%7.1%
201247.0%34.6%10.5%7.2%
201148.8%32.3%12.7%5.1%
201048.2%29.5%14.0%6.7%

Employment Sector FAQs for Lincoln County, Colorado

The largest employment sector in Lincoln County, Colorado is Private For-Profit, which employs 52.0% of the local workforce.

There are approximately 2,118 civilian workers aged 16 and over currently employed in Lincoln County, Colorado.

In the private for-profit sector, the male-to-female ratio is 0.89:1. This metric helps highlight gender participation across the most prominent industry classes.

Since 2010, the total number of workers in Lincoln County, Colorado has shown a decrease, moving from 2,190 to 2,118 according to Census Bureau records.
